Defining “Exotics” in Pot Culture?
In cannabis lingo, “exotics” refer to scarce, high‑grade marijuana strains that distinguish themselves in flavor, scent, look, and effects. These strains are often grown in small batches by boutique cultivators who focus on quality over mass production.
Exotics typically boast colorful buds, heavy resin coverage, distinctive smells, elevated THC levels, and rich terpene arrays.
These traits differentiate exotics from standard strains. Unlike mass-produced cannabis, exotics are bred and cultivated with refinement, resulting in a more exclusive product. Connoisseurs often seek exotics for their smooth smoke, unique taste, and enhanced highs.

Why Runtz Is Legendary?
Among all exotic strains, Runtz shines as a legend. Bred by crossing Zkittlez and Gelato, Runtz is famous for its sugary, candy‑like flavor and smooth high. The name Runtz comes from the Runtz candy, and the comparison is fitting—this strain smells and tastes like sugary fruit with a smooth, creamy finish.
Runtz typically features THC content between 24 to 29 percent, a blend of euphoria and relaxation, bright greens, purples, and oranges, and dense nugs covered in milky trichomes.
Runtz has many variations, including “White Runtz”, known for its frostiness and intense body high; Pink Runtz, with a fruity profile and gentler high; and “Obama Runtz”, a hybrid strain with potent head high.
These variations provide varied effects, but all share the genetic excellence that make Runtz a premier exotic.

How to Spot Fake Runtz
The exponential rise means Runtz is now one of the easiest to fake. Here are clues you might be dealing with a fake:
• Poor packaging or blurry logos
• Unusually low prices
• Lack of lab reports or traceability
• No brand reputation or online presence
Avoid uncertified sellers and always opt for licensed or verified exotics stores. Ask the staff about the source farm, lab testing, and specific traits of the strain to ensure authenticity.
